about me

I am based in the village of Collingham, on the Nottinghamshire–Lincolnshire border in the United Kingdom. I moved to the area from Nottingham in 2022. I spent my teenage years in Cleethorpes and I have since lived in various places across Derbyshire, Nottinghamshire and Lincolnshire.

I had a 30-year career in the IT Industry, working for a range of small and large companies including Capita, Tata Consultancy Services and Boots. I worked in project delivery, progressing on to Head of Department roles. The leadership roles enabled me to engage with, get to know and manage a diverse range of people. Through this, I established a love of developing, mentoring and coaching people. This passion led to me studying as a coach to work with a wider range of people who want to understand and achieve their goals.

I have a lifelong interest in psychology, learning and personal development. I have a strong ability to connect with people, creating conversations that give space and focus, and bring empathy. I am driven by the desire to help people be the best that they can, and to unlock belief in their own needs and capabilities. I am a Transformative Life Coach working across a number of different areas and am studying for an Accredited Diploma in Transformative Coaching. I have experience of working with a wide range of situations, including significant life changes, career changes, changing mindsets, mental health challenges, relationship difficulties and neuro diversity.

I am trained in Transcendental Meditation (TM) and I am studying the ancient Vedic traditions that the TM technique comes from, including yoga positions, breathing techniques and Ayurveda health care. The Vedic concepts of stress release, knowledge, alignment and a harmonious way of life provide a strong complement to coaching.
